From fc2f29dc29925e0c07244a1475b8f948e7183be3 Mon Sep 17 00:00:00 2001 From: leex279 Date: Tue, 9 Sep 2025 23:50:16 +0200 Subject: [PATCH] debug: switch to print statements for more visible logging M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it Use print() instead of safe_logfire_info() to ensure debug output is visible in Docker logs immediately. 🤖 Generated with [Claude Code](https://claude.ai/code) Co-Authored-By: Claude --- .../src/server/services/knowledge/knowledge_item_service.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/python/src/server/services/knowledge/knowledge_item_service.py b/python/src/server/services/knowledge/knowledge_item_service.py index 98b01201..fc05e760 100644 --- a/python/src/server/services/knowledge/knowledge_item_service.py +++ b/python/src/server/services/knowledge/knowledge_item_service.py @@ -354,7 +354,7 @@ class KnowledgeItemService: source_id = source["source_id"] # Debug: log the raw source record to see what we're getting from the database - safe_logfire_info(f"Raw source record for {source_id}: {source}") + print(f"🔍 DEBUG: Raw source record for {source_id}: {source}") # Get first page URL first_page_url = await self._get_first_page_url(source_id) @@ -367,8 +367,8 @@ class KnowledgeItemService: # Log URL resolution for debugging - include full metadata for debugging original_url = source_metadata.get("original_url") - safe_logfire_info(f"URL resolution for {source_id}: source_metadata={source_metadata}") - safe_logfire_info(f"URL resolution for {source_id}: original_url={original_url}, first_page_url={first_page_url}") + print(f"🔍 DEBUG: URL resolution for {source_id}: source_metadata={source_metadata}") + print(f"🔍 DEBUG: URL resolution for {source_id}: original_url={original_url}, first_page_url={first_page_url}") # More robust URL resolution with fallback chain display_url = original_url